From: Rico Tzschichholz Date: Sat, 23 Oct 2021 13:27:12 +0000 (+0200) Subject: parser: Make sure ErrorCodes are accessible as needed X-Git-Tag: 0.52.7~4 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=97fa0f08c491f12961ce02c667a52306beb3557a;p=thirdparty%2Fvala.git parser: Make sure ErrorCodes are accessible as needed --- diff --git a/vala/valagenieparser.vala b/vala/valagenieparser.vala index 43ff863de..aacbaceca 100644 --- a/vala/valagenieparser.vala +++ b/vala/valagenieparser.vala @@ -3515,6 +3515,7 @@ public class Vala.Genie.Parser : CodeVisitor { string id = parse_identifier (); comment = scanner.pop_comment (); var ec = new ErrorCode (id, get_src (code_begin), comment); + ec.access = SymbolAccessibility.PUBLIC; set_attributes (ec, code_attrs); if (accept (TokenType.ASSIGN)) { ec.value = parse_expression (); diff --git a/vala/valaparser.vala b/vala/valaparser.vala index fcfa33483..84f1f39a0 100644 --- a/vala/valaparser.vala +++ b/vala/valaparser.vala @@ -3440,6 +3440,7 @@ public class Vala.Parser : CodeVisitor { } var ec = new ErrorCode (id, get_src (code_begin), comment); + ec.access = SymbolAccessibility.PUBLIC; set_attributes (ec, code_attrs); if (accept (TokenType.ASSIGN)) { ec.value = parse_expression ();